- Chauri Chaura:-
- The incident took place on February 4, 1922, in the Chauri Chaura village of Uttar Pradesh, India.
- It was a violent clash between the Indian protesters and the British police, which resulted in the death of 22 policemen and three civilians.
- The incident led to the suspension of the non-cooperation movement launched by Mahatma Gandhi, as he believed that the violence was against the principles of non-violent protest.
- The Chauri Chaura incident is considered a turning point in the Indian freedom struggle as it shifted the focus from non-cooperation to civil disobedience movement.
